For some that comes from certain countries, you may be aware that you can get Medicare cover once you have entered Australia. This sounds great! However, you need to understand that those that do not possess health insurance have a Medicare surcharge attached to their taxes – which can then mean this is not the cheapest option. If you then consider that this is a policy you will be holding onto, it is then worth asking whether just the basic requirements is really all you want?
One key question is whether the policy has a hospital excess, and for Frank singles 485 visa health insurance this is a definite yes. Which means that if you then do need to use a hospital, it will come at a cost – so there is a risk with that cheap price.
